Heated Lens (De-icing LED Lights)
A heated-lens LED light has a transparent heating element laminated onto the lens that melts snow and ice — solving the problem that efficient LEDs, unlike halogens, produce too little waste heat to keep their own lens clear.
Halogen lamps kept themselves clear of snow by accident: 80 % of their power was waste heat. LEDs are efficient enough that a snow-plow’s forward lights can bury themselves in slush mid-route. A heated lens restores the melting function deliberately, drawing power only when the lens temperature drops.
How it works
A conductive transparent layer warms the lens surface — typically activating automatically below around 5 °C. The machine cannot stop mid-route for the operator to climb down and scrape a lens, so the de-icing runs unattended.
Who needs it
Snow plows, spreaders, municipal fleets and any machine on winter-service duty. Sheltered rear or cab locations often manage without heating; forward-facing lamps take the full snow load and benefit most. See our heated LED lights range, including ECE-approved heated plow headlights.
